Spread spectrum technology has the great meanings on the military and public communication. At the same time, software radio develops so rapidly that it' s significant to study the digital realization of marine shortwave direct-spectrum system applying its concept and general hardware platform.in the paper it sets forth the spread spectrum' s theory, specifications, types, characteristics and m sequence' s properties, furthermore, the models of DS transmitter and receiver are given. The algorithms on the sampling, multi-velocity signal processing, digital orthogonal mixing frequency, demodulation of BPSK and synchronization of PN code are studied, in addition, it finishes the Kaiser and integral comb filters. The parameters of earth wave transmit, atmosphere noise, transmitter' s antenna efficiency is simulated, which provide the basis for the receiver' s technology specifications.Based on the specifications, DS-SS digital receiver is achieved including the front analog amplifier, A/D sampling, digital down converter (DDC), baseband signal processing and assistant circuits. Appling the software algorithms it achieves the mixing frequency, multi-order decimation and alias rejection filters. In the DSP it accomplishes the configuration of AD6620, data transmission and BPSK demodulation. Parallel boot mode of 16-bit is achieved so that the whole spread spectrum digital system is finished. CPLD completes the system' s clock control and coding. Communication interface with the computer is set in order to extend the application.
